Disk 90/10 copper-nickel-iron to alley designation CN102 or atternatively DIN 20872, Dimensions Flange: Based on BS 1560 (ANSIB16.5) Class 300, Slsed on DIv86037 ‘SPECTACLE, RING AND BLIND SPADE FLANGES Spectacle, Ring and Blind Spade Flanges clad with 90/10 CCopper-nickel-iton are available in sizes up to and including 24/61 0mm {or Class 300, 20 bar g rated systems ‘a 16 5 647 a 143 080 % 25 7 826 % 159 130 7 30 124 269 % 175: 166 1 8 133, 964 % 190 220 Te co 156 143 % 206 320, z 7 165; 1270 % 222 375 3 761 210 183 Th 286 785 = 389) Te42 10.65, +108 2000 13.66 6 159 2699 Te 365 22 a 2191 3302 7 a3 390) 10-267 3874 620 2 339 4508 68.1 a 4 38 5144 140 16 a9 S715 Te 572 1490 18 9572 6286 Ta 603 1890 20 —~808 6858 Pa os Bio a 610 8128 1% 698 3630 ‘Yorkshire’ Marine Range Capillary Silver Brazing Fittings Type This range of fittings is suitable for use with tubes having the following actual C.D.’ men) — 16, 25, 30, 38, 445, 57 — in accordance with BS 2871 Part 2: 1972: Table 3 Alloy Fittings ar manufactured from either aluminium brass (alloy CZ_110) or gunmetal alloy LG2-C} and are immune to Gezinaificauon, ‘Where castings are incorporated in the range these are indicated by 3 @ Sllver-Brazing Alloy Rings All fittings incorporate integral siver-brazirg alloy rings and under normal circumstances there is gereraily roneedto ‘end feed! with additional brazing alloy. The sitver-brazing alloy to BS 1845: 1977-Type AG 14, contains a maximum of 0.05% cadmium as impurity. sOTES ON INSTALLATION PRACTICE Cleantiness Never attempt to make ajoint with dirty tubes ordity fittings. Sandpaper (grade ‘©’ or alumina-based paper or cloth should bbe used for cleaning. Disconnecting Fittings Joints made with "Yorkshire" Siver Brazing fittings should be Tegarded as permanent. If it anticipated tat the system wi have to be broken into, disconnecting fitungs such as No. 11 MHD should be installed atappropriate points. Disconnecting fittings are also valuable in enabling sections of the installauon, to be completed on a work bench to avoid making joints in difficult or awkwerd places. This prefebrication technique is, particularly recommended in the case of the larger sizes. For flameless repair work the 1 SU fitingisrecommended. This is ‘a manipulative cone joint incorporating a PTFE seal. A special leaflet is available on request. Union Joints Union type fittings... No, ||, have round-nase to cone seat Joints and to ensure freedom from leaks, care must taken to ‘avoid damage to the jointing faces With joints ofthis type itis essential to use a suitable jointing compound, or ape (PTFE} 10 ensure completely satisfactory results Threads ‘Allthe male ronstud and fermate iron end are either parallel 0 8S 2779 and intemational standard 1179, of API/NPT taper. Flux Easy-fio’ flux is fecommended and is speciaty suitable for use with Yorkshire’ Siver Brazing fittings. Satisfactory joints can. however, be made with other suitable silver brazing fixtures.
